Types of Plastic Bumpers and Materials

Thermoplastic Olefin (TPO) – Most Common OEM Material

TPO is lightweight, flexible, and relatively inexpensive. It is resistant to UV damage and doesn’t require painting with adhesion promoters. Approximately 70% of OEM bumpers on Japanese and American vehicles (Toyota, Honda, Ford, Chevrolet) are made from TPO. Why TPO? It is recyclable, has excellent impact resistance down to -30°F, and doesn’t become brittle in cold weather.

Polyurethane (PUR or PU) – Premium Material

Polyurethane is more flexible and impact-resistant than TPO but heavier and more expensive. Used on luxury vehicles (BMW, Mercedes-Benz, Audi) and performance cars. Polyurethane bumpers can be repaired more easily than TPO (plastic welding works well). Polycarbonate (PC) + Acrylonitrile Butadiene Styrene (ABS) – Rigid, Less Common

Used on some European vehicles and aftermarket body kits. PC/ABS is stiffer than TPO or polyurethane, which means it cracks rather than flexing on impact. It also requires careful painting with specialized primers. Not recommended for daily drivers in cold climates.

Step-by-Step Front Bumper Replacement Guide

Replacing a Car Front Rear Bumper Auto Body Parts Plastic Bumper OEM Custom Design is a moderate DIY job (2-4 hours). Professional shop time: 1.5-2.5 hours.

Tools needed: Plastic trim removal tools (set of pry bars), Phillips and flathead screwdrivers, 8mm, 10mm, 12mm sockets, ratchet and extensions, Torx bits (T20, T25, T30—common on European vehicles), panel clip removal tool, floor jack and jack stands (if you need to access lower bolts), microfiber towels, masking tape.

Safety warning: Some vehicles have airbag sensors mounted to the bumper reinforcement bar. Disconnect the negative battery terminal and wait 10 minutes before working near these sensors to prevent accidental airbag deployment.

Step 1: Prepare the vehicle

Park on level ground. Turn off the engine and disconnect the negative battery terminal (if your vehicle has front airbag sensors). Mask the edges of the fenders and hood with painter’s tape to prevent scratching when removing the bumper.

Step 2: Remove grille and trim pieces (if needed)

On many vehicles, the upper grille must be removed before the bumper. Use a trim removal tool to pry grille clips. On a 2017 Ford Fusion, the grille is held by 6 clips and 2 screws. On a 2019 Honda CR-V, the chrome grille trim must come off first.

Step 3: Remove wheel well liner screws

Turn the steering wheel to full lock (left for passenger side access, right for driver side). Remove screws or clips securing the front portion of the wheel well liner to the bumper. Typically 3-5 Phillips or 8mm screws per side. Why? The bumper is attached to the fender through the wheel well.

Step 4: Remove under-engine cover screws

Crawl under the front of the vehicle. Remove screws or clips securing the under-engine cover (splash shield) to the bottom of the bumper. Typically 6-10 screws (8mm or 10mm). On a 2015 Toyota Camry, there are 8 clips along the bottom edge.

Step 5: Remove upper bumper bolts

Open the hood. Look along the top edge of the bumper (under the hood seal). Remove bolts or screws securing the bumper to the radiator support. Typically 4-6 bolts (10mm). On a 2020 Hyundai Elantra, there are 4 bolts across the top.

Step 6: Disconnect fog lights, sensors, and DRLs

Before pulling the bumper off, reach behind the bumper and disconnect electrical connectors for:

  • Fog lights (if equipped)
  • Parking sensors (small round sensors)
  • Front camera (if equipped)
  • Active grille shutters (if equipped—these are motorized)
  • Ambient temperature sensor (often clipped to the lower grille)

Take photos of the connector locations and wire routing before disconnecting.

Step 7: Pull the bumper off

Starting at one wheel well, gently pull the bumper away from the fender. The bumper is held by plastic clips that snap into brackets on the fender. Work your way across the front, pulling outward and forward. Why not pull straight down? The bumper slides forward off these clips. Pulling down can break the tabs.

On some vehicles (e.g., 2018 BMW 3 Series), the bumper is also held by two screws behind the fog light housings—remove these first.

Step 8: Transfer components to the new bumper

Place the old and new bumpers side by side. Transfer the following:

  • Fog light housings (or buy new ones)
  • Parking sensors (push out from behind)
  • Grille assembly (screws or clips)
  • Tow hook cover (if your vehicle has one)
  • License plate bracket
  • Foam energy absorber (the thick foam between bumper cover and reinforcement bar)
  • Reinforcement bar (metal beam behind the foam)—only if your new bumper did not come with one

Case Example: On a 2016 Nissan Altima, the foam absorber is glued to the old bumper. Use a heat gun to soften the adhesive (150-180°F) and a plastic scraper to remove the foam. Apply new double-sided automotive tape to attach it to the new bumper.

Step 9: Install the new bumper

Reverse the removal process:

  • Clip the bumper onto the fender brackets (start at one corner and work across)
  • Reinstall upper bolts (torque to 5-8 ft-lb—just snug, do not overtighten plastic)
  • Reinstall wheel well liner screws
  • Reinstall under-engine cover screws
  • Reinstall grille
  • Reconnect all electrical connectors

Step 10: Test all lights and sensors

Reconnect the battery. Turn on the headlights, fog lights (if equipped), and turn signals. Test parking sensors by putting the vehicle in reverse or drive (with an assistant) and walking in front of the sensors—you should hear beeping. Check the front camera (if equipped) on the infotainment screen.

Step 11: Check alignment

Stand back 10-20 feet. The bumper should be evenly aligned with the hood, fenders, and headlights. Gaps should be consistent (typically 3-5mm). If the bumper is crooked, loosen the upper bolts and adjust.

Step-by-Step Rear Bumper Replacement

Rear bumper replacement is similar but often easier (fewer electrical connections).

Step 1: Open the trunk. Remove the trunk floor cover and spare tire cover (if needed to access bolts).

Step 2: Remove tail lights (on some vehicles). The rear bumper may be partially held by tail light assemblies. On a 2017 Kia Optima, both tail lights must be removed (2-3 nuts each) to access bumper bolts.

Step 3: Remove wheel well liner screws (same as front).

Step 4: Remove under-bumper screws (same as front).

Step 5: Remove bumper bolts from inside the trunk (usually 2-4 bolts, 10mm or 12mm).

Step 6: Disconnect rear parking sensors and license plate lights.

Step 7: Pull the bumper off (same as front).

Step 8: Transfer components (parking sensors, license plate light housings, foam absorber).

Painting Your New Bumper (If Primed)

If you bought a primed bumper, painting is required. You have three options:

Option 1: Professional body shop ($200-500). Best color match, guaranteed finish. The shop will sand, prime (if needed), base coat, and clear coat. Expect 2-3 days turnaround.

Option 2: DIY with aerosol cans ($50-150). Suitable for solid colors (white, black, red) but difficult for metallics or pearls. Steps:

  • Clean bumper with soap and water, then grease and wax remover
  • Sand with 600-grit sandpaper (wet)
  • Apply adhesion promoter (for TPO or polyurethane)
  • Apply primer (2-3 light coats)
  • Apply base coat color (3-4 light coats)
  • Apply clear coat (2-3 coats)
  • Allow to dry 24-48 hours before handling

Option 3: DIY with HVLP spray gun ($150-300 equipment + materials). Better results than aerosol but requires a compressor and practice. Use 2K paint (with hardener) for durability.

Why painting is critical: Unpainted bumpers are UV-sensitive and will fade, chalk, or yellow within 6-12 months. Always paint or apply a wrap to a primed bumper.

Common Problems and Solutions

Problem 1: Bumper doesn’t fit—gaps are too wide. Solution: The bumper may have warped during shipping (common with fiberglass, less common with TPO or polyurethane). Use a heat gun (300-400°F) to warm the warped area and gently bend it into shape. Hold it in position until cool. On a 2014 Ford Focus aftermarket bumper, the passenger side gap was 12mm (should be 4mm)—heating and bending reduced it to 5mm.

Problem 2: Parking sensors don’t work after replacement. Solution: Check that the sensors are fully seated in their housings (they should click). Also, verify that the bumper paint thickness around the sensors is not excessive (paint should be less than 0.5mm thick over the sensor face). Some aftermarket bumpers have thicker material that blocks ultrasonic waves—you may need to sand the inside of the sensor mounting holes to thin the material.

Problem 3: Bumper vibrates or rattles at highway speeds. Solution: Missing or broken clips. Buy a box of automotive push-pin clips (assortment kit, $10-20). Also check that the under-engine cover is fully secured—a loose cover catches wind and vibrates the bumper.

Problem 4: Paint peels or chips within months. Solution: The painter skipped the adhesion promoter step. TPO and polyurethane bumpers have low surface energy—paint will not stick without adhesion promoter. Repaint correctly: sand, clean, apply adhesion promoter, then primer, base, clear.

Q3: What’s the difference between “bumper cover” and “bumper reinforcement”? A: The bumper cover is the painted plastic outer shell (the part you see). The bumper reinforcement is the metal or aluminum beam behind the cover that actually absorbs impact. Most custom bumpers are covers only—you reuse your existing reinforcement beam. Some off-road bumpers replace both the cover and reinforcement with a single steel unit.

Regional and Legal Considerations

  • California: Aftermarket bumpers must not remove or obstruct factory-installed airbag sensors. The front bumper must have a “5 mph impact” energy absorber (foam). Many custom bumpers delete the foam—this is illegal in CA and will cause a failed inspection.
  • Europe (ECE regulations): Bumpers must not have sharp edges and must protect pedestrians (rounded surfaces). Many US-market custom bumpers are not ECE-approved.
  • Australia (ADR compliance): Bumpers must not protrude beyond the original dimensions more than 50mm. Check local laws before ordering a widebody or extended bumper.
  • Canada (CMVSS): Similar to US DOT rules. Bumpers must not interfere with lighting or sensors.

Preventive Maintenance for Your Bumper

Interval Action Why
Every car wash Inspect for rock chips and scratches Touch up immediately to prevent rust on metal bumpers (steel) or peeling on plastic
Every 6 months Check all bumper clips and screws Loose bumpers vibrate and crack at mounting points
Annually Wax or seal the bumper (painted surfaces) UV protection prevents fading and clearcoat failure
After any minor collision Remove bumper and inspect foam absorber Foam compresses on impact and will not protect in a second collision—replace if crushed
